afternoon action: The pound in particular saw big swings on the day, according to Market Watch. After trading flat against the dollar for much of the morning session, it saw a pronounced move higher, though the Brexit-battered currency continued to trade near multidecade lows. Trading was volatile, with many currencies extending their gains against the dollar in afternoon action. The ICE U.S. Dollar Index DXY, +0.55% which measures the greenback against a half-dozen rivals, dipped 0.4% to 97.56. The WSJ Dollar Index BUXX, +0.39% —a measure of the dollar against a basket of major currencies—was down 0.3% at 88.13. On Wednesday, it ended at its highest level since March.
